What Is Ajelix?
Ajelix is an AI-driven formula assistant designed for both Excel and Google Sheets. It uses natural language processing to understand your goals and instantly generate accurate formulas. Beyond creation, it explains complex formulas in plain English, debugs errors, and suggests optimizations. In 2026, the tool has been updated to support the latest Excel functions, including LAMBDA, LET, and dynamic arrays. It is ideal for financial analysts, data scientists, accountants, students, and business owners who need to save time and reduce errors.

How Ajelix Works
Using Ajelix is straightforward. First, describe the desired outcome in natural language within the interface. For instance, type “Calculate average sales per month for the last quarter.” Ajelix’s AI processes the request and returns a formula like =AVERAGEIFS(Sales, Date, ">=1/1/2026", Date, "<=3/31/2026"). You can then copy it directly into your spreadsheet. Alternatively, if you have an existing formula that isn’t working, paste it into Ajelix’s debugger. The tool highlights potential issues—such as mismatched ranges or missing parentheses—and suggests corrections. For learning, the explainer mode breaks down each function step-by-step using color-coded segments. The entire process takes seconds, dramatically reducing trial-and-error time.

Pricing and Plans
Ajelix offers a generous free tier: 10 formula queries per month—enough to test its capabilities. The Pro plan costs $9 per month and includes 200 queries, priority support, and advanced features like dynamic array formulas and data cleaning recommendations. The Business plan at $19 per month provides unlimited queries, team collaboration with shared explanation links, and custom integrations via API. Annual billing brings a 20% discount, making the Pro plan just $7.20/month. All plans include the full explainer and debugger tools. There is no long-term contract; you can cancel anytime. For heavy users, the Business plan delivers the best value, especially for teams handling large spreadsheets daily.
